I thought some people might be interested in this AGNULA Libre Music - a repository for music whose licenses (e.g. the Creative Commons Attribution-Sharealike License) allow free redistribution and usage. While there are a lot of sites on the net that allow one access to free, and legal, music (e.g. Soundclick.com), the licenses associated with much of the music on these sites often prevents free redistribution. So AGNULA Libre Music is a very welcome development in my view. P.S. The AGNULA project itself is one to create a "A GNU Linux Audio Distribution". They've already achieved much of their goal from what I know - a lot of musicians are already using their distribution(s).
